Join us for an eye-opening documentary that follows Captain Charles Moore and his team as they sail through the Pacific Garbage Patch, collecting data, gathering samples, and raising awareness about the environmental and wildlife impacts of oceanic plastic pollution found far from shore. Following the film there will be a panel discussion.

Meet Captain Moore, who discovered the Great Pacific Garbage Patch in 1997, and enjoy light refreshments before viewing the film. Guests will have the opportunity to ask questions during the panel discussion featuring Captain Moore and local experts.
